Output 81d75528c74ceafd9d71d39c81eb791c92da5ed7e7b3688f3194bb693bc24512:0

value
4187661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50e1c8dc3d6674c0850f050ef2d70b2b900648d8 OP_EQUALVERIFY OP_CHECKSIG
address
18NfY8uBqz7LinwNXt86Ls4mYGbbqrKiHK
transaction
81d75528c74ceafd9d71d39c81eb791c92da5ed7e7b3688f3194bb693bc24512
confirmations
405066
spent
true